Medical Records

Medical records are an essential part of any injury case. They offer hard evidence to support an injury claim and also assist lawyers determine the viability of a lawsuit and the amount of compensation given. Medical records from doctors, emergency rooms, hospitals, therapists, and specialists are necessary to provide complete information regarding the nature and severity of injuries that have been suffered in an accident.

They can contain details like an inventory of symptoms, the duration of time the patient has been experiencing them and the expense of treating their injuries. Imaging studies and x-rays are crucial for demonstrating the severity of damage. A doctor's prognosis for the future will provide valuable information about how long the injured person can expect to suffer from their injury.

Although releasing medical records to an insurance company may seem invasive, it's necessary to make sure that they're getting the whole story. This will aid in establishing the causality and result in an award of substantial compensation. These records will be sought by the insurance company in the form a court order or subpoena. Your lawyer can ensure that only the relevant records to your case are sent.

Witness Statements

Witness statements are a critical element of evidence in any personal injury attorney near me case. Lawyers rely upon them to determine the timeframes, the actions of the parties involved, and their impact on clients. Therefore, it is crucial to obtain statements from eyewitnesses as soon after the accident as you can, while the incident is still fresh in the mind.

Anyone can write the statement, including spouses family members, colleagues, or even friends. It should address who, what and where questions regarding the incident. It should also contain specifics, such as the conditions of the weather at the time of the accident, as well as any obstructions or blind curves that affected visibility, and road surface conditions.

The ideal witnesses are impartial, non-affiliated parties who are able to provide an impartial view of what transpired. Some witnesses are affected by their biases and emotions. The witness should not offer any opinions or arguments during their statement. Instead, they should focus on proving the facts of what happened and leave any criticism to the jury.

Another reason it is important to get witness statements as soon as you can after the incident is the fact that memories fade with time. If a witness remembers something differently than what was actually happening at the moment of the accident, it could be confusing for the judge or the insurance company. Photographs

Photographs of a lawyer injury accident are among the most valuable pieces of evidence that can be used to back the personal injury claim. They can be extremely beneficial in showing the negligence of the other party or pain and suffering as well as medical bills, estimates of property damage as well as other expenses relating to the accident. Photos can help a juror or insurance adjuster as well as your personal injury lawyer comprehend the scene of the crash and the events you went through.

Photographs are particularly important if the responsibility for an accident is unclear. They can help experts determine which actions could have contributed to a collision by examining details like skid marks, the final resting positions of the vehicles, and patterns in the damage. When combined with witness testimony and other forms of evidence, photographs leave little room for interpretation. This can make it easier to settle a dispute in court rather than contesting it.

Photographing the scene of the accident is simple using most smart phones and other cameras. You should take a number of photos of the scene from different angles. If you are able you can also capture video. Note the date and the time on the back of every photograph or ask a friend to. Do not touch or move any object in your photos. Also, do not make use of Photoshop to edit the photos. This could be considered altering the image.

Once you are healed after your recovery, it's a good idea to capture photos of your injuries at different stages of recovery and document the progression over time. This can be particularly useful for proving your losses for future damages.

Demand Letter

A demand letter is a formal document that your injurys attorney near me will send to your insurer to claim compensation for your loss. The letter typically outlines who you are, how your accident happened and why you need compensation. The letter will include the full details of your injuries, how they have affected you and any economic expenses, such as medical bills and lost wages, as well as non-economic damages like discomfort and pain, loss of quality and emotional anxiety. The letter should also contain any evidence to support your claim. This could include medical records, police reports and witness statements.

A good personal injury lawyer near me lawyer will assist you in determining the amount to request in your demand letter. This will be based upon your damages and comparable settlements or verdicts for similar incidents that have occurred in the region. They will also take into consideration any unique circumstances in your case that may influence the final outcome.

Once your personal injury lawyer has prepared and sent the demand letter There will be a waiting period before you get a response from the insurance company. This will depend on the amount of time it takes the insurance company to comb through your claim and examine your case. It can also be impacted by their work load and the volume of cases they are currently handling.

In certain situations the insurance company may respond by denying the demands you make or by submitting a counteroffer that is significantly lower than the one you are willing to accept.
